pET30a-HS-Tn5
(Plasmid #127916)

Backbone

  • Vector backbone
    pET30a
  • Vector type
    Bacterial Expression

Growth in Bacteria

  • Bacterial Resistance(s)
    Kanamycin, 50 μg/mL
  • Growth Temperature
    37°C
  • Growth Strain(s)
    DH5alpha
  • Copy number
    High Copy

Gene/Insert

  • Gene/Insert name
    Hyperstable Tn5
  • Alt name
    HS-Tn5
  • Mutation
    E54K, L372P
  • Promoter T7
  • Tags / Fusion Proteins
    • E coli elongation factor Ts (N terminal on insert)
    • Mxe intein - Chitin-binding domain (C terminal on insert)
